Handing off the Quillbus broker upgrade (4.x to 5.1) to Dario. Cluster is half-migrated; mixed-version mode is supported but TLS cert rotation must finish before cutover. No auth model changes, though the admin API gained two new endpoints worth reviewing. Open questions and the migration checklist are tracked on the internal page below.

dashboard of taduf-bawef = https://jira.lumicsys.internal/projects/display/browse/b1cbf89d

The bounce processor on Mailwright CI is failing its integration stage because the fixture mailbox expired mid-run, so every test message now hard-bounces and the suite flags a false regression. Re-running won't help until the fixture is reseeded by the morning job. If paged tonight, acknowledge and snooze; no production impact, since the live processor uses a separate mailbox. Confirm the failing run matches the trace token below before closing the page.

pipeline stamp: htk31_f769b577b3028a4e9958e5bb8d1259a

Runbook: Orphaned-Resource Sweeper (Tidewrack)

Tidewrack runs hourly and reclaims volumes, load balancers, and DNS records left behind by deleted environments. If the sweep stalls, check the janitor queue depth first; a backlog over 500 usually means a tagging outage upstream. Do not re-run the sweep manually while a pass is in flight — duplicate deletions have caused incidents before. To trigger a controlled re-sweep, call the Tidewrack admin endpoint, which authenticates against the internal ops service using the key below.

gateway credential: kto23_LX9A4ys6i4nzHtpOLNLodKK

Ticket PX-2281 — SFTP drop signature check failing for partner Brindlevale. Since Thursday, every manifest landing in the Coppermoor drop folder bounces with a bad-signature error, so the nightly reconcile is stuck. Looks like Brindlevale rotated on their end without telling us, and our verifier still pins the stale fingerprint. Tomas confirmed the payloads themselves are fine. Fix: update the pinned verification material and rerun the stuck batch. Their current signing key follows.

signing key of baduf-taweg = bky6_Zf7bem